問題タブ [fb.ui]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
2 に答える
1165 参照

iphone - Facebook iOS アプリケーションの共有リンクからモバイル Web アプリケーションを開く

Javascript SDK を使用して Facebook に接続し、Graph API を使用してユーザー情報を取得するモバイル Web アプリケーションがあります。iPhone でテストする場合、サイトは Safari から正常に動作しますが、ユーザーがステータス ポストに Web サイトへのリンクを追加し、サイトが Facebook iPhone アプリケーション内で開かれると、ログイン JavaScript が呼び出されません。

現在、FB.UI メソッド:'permissions.request' を使用していますが、他の fb.ui ダイアログなどを呼び出してみましたが、何も読み込まれません。

これらを Facebook iPhone アプリ内から機能させる方法はありますか? リンクを Facebook アプリケーションではなく Safari で強制的に開く方法はありますか?

0 投票する
1 に答える
891 参照

facebook - FaceBook FB.uiログアウトが起動しない

そのコードは正常に機能します。今は後が好きです:

Facebookから静かにログアウトするにはどうすればよいですか?

そのコードを追加した後、alert('post publish')何もしませんでした!!

私は発見しました:「サーバーサイドワークフロー」(OAuth 2.0)を使用してログインした後にFB auth.logoutが発生していますが、私が求めていることを理解するのに十分なコードを理解しているかどうかはわかりません!

0 投票する
2 に答える
4190 参照

javascript - Facebookの表示:「ページ」がFB.uiで機能せず、ポップアップがブラウザによってブロックされている

許可されていないアプリケーションに対してFacebookでiframeが許可されていないことは知っていますが、表示を取得できません:'page'もFB.uiで動作します。動作している唯一の表示モードはポップアップです。ログインダイアログとFB.uiダイアログはどちらも、Facebookログインを使用して他のすべてのWebサイトで機能しているにもかかわらず、ポップアップブロッカーによってブロックされています。ユーザーがクリックしてFB.login関数とFB.ui関数が呼び出された場合でも、ポップアップブロッカーが起動します。これは本当に、本当に迷惑です。だから私を助けてください。

0 投票する
1 に答える
4872 参照

facebook - FB.ui フィード ダイアログは画像属性を「無視」し、代わりにキャッシュされた og:image タグを使用します

ここに私のFB.uiコードがあります:

ダイアログは完全にポップアップし、リンクがあるので問題ありません...しかし、画像は表示されません。

写真の URL が正しいことを確認しました。次に、デバッガーを使用して、コンテンツ URL のオープン グラフ タグをテストしました。問題なく動作します。

どうやら、デバッガーはある種のキャッシュをクリアします。リンクでデバッガーを使用した後、FB.uiダイアログに問題なく画像が表示されます。

これについて何かできることはありますか?ユーザーが私のサイトから Facebook に共有しているコンテンツは、画像が本来のように表示されず、使用するのが少し面倒です (これは決して良いことではありません!)。

ありがとう!

0 投票する
1 に答える
557 参照

sendmessage - Facebook 送信メッセージで間違った URL が入力される

Facebook 送信ソーシャル プラグインまたは fb.ui 送信ダイアログのいずれかを使用しようとしています。どちらの場合も、facebook に渡すリンクまたは href はほとんど機能しないことがわかりました。メッセージにリンクを配置する場所は 3 つあります。

  1. メッセージのタイトル
  2. タイトルすぐ下のリンク
  3. 説明の左側の画像

1 と 3 はリンク パラメータを尊重しているように見えますが、2 はそうではありません。使用しているコードの例を次に示します。

これが送信されると、リンクhttps://www.oursite.com/?refer=123は名前と画像に対して機能しますが、名前のすぐ下に出力されるリンクは機能しません。以下は、同じ効果をもたらすソーシャル プラグインに使用しているコードです。

0 投票する
1 に答える
807 参照

facebook - Facebook oauth ダイアログがコールバック関数を呼び出さない

FB.ui method='oauth' が本番サイトでコールバック関数の呼び出しを停止したようです。コードは次のとおりです。

FB.getLoginStatus を単純なアラートに置き換えようとしましたが、呼び出されません。FB.getLoginStatus(checkFBConnect, true); を呼び出すと、デバッグ コンソールから手動で実行すると、プロセスはすべて意図したとおりに機能します。私たちの関数(応答)がFacebookによって呼び出されることはないようです。

0 投票する
0 に答える
314 参照

javascript - FB カスタム タブの URL 投稿の説明を変更する

壁のカスタム タブからリンクを貼り付けると、説明がカスタム タブではなく情報タブから取得されていることに気付きました。説明をカスタムタブに関連するものに変更したいと思います。誰もこれを行う方法を知っていますか?

投稿されたリンクの下の説明は、http://www.facebook.com/commerzbankcareer?sk=app_265085363536247 というソースからのものではありませんが、この http://www.facebook.com/commerzbankcareer?sk=info からのものです

Facebook SDK のカスタム タブの PHP ファイルに FB.ui フィード ダイアログを追加しようとしましたが、うまくいきませんでした:

0 投票する
2 に答える
784 参照

facebook - facebookfb.uiダイアログの開きが低すぎます

問題が発生していて、それを処理するためのリソースが見つかりません。おそらく、ここの誰かが手がかりを持っているでしょう...

fb.uiダイアログを使用するFacebookアプリがあります。問題は、開く値が低すぎることです。[承認/キャンセル]をクリックするには、下にスクロールする必要があります。

私が見つけた唯一のリソースは 、がタグ<div id="fb-root"></div>のすぐ下にあることを確認するように私に言いました<body>、そしてこれは私のアプリの場合です...

誰かアイデアはありますか?ありがとう、ヤニパン

0 投票する
2 に答える
4556 参照

facebook-like - Like ボタンと FB.ui (apprequests) を同じページで使用すると競合が発生する

キャンバス アプリで問題が発生しました。Like ボタンのコードが有効になっている場合、FB.ui 呼び出し 'apprequests' でエラーが発生します。いいねボタンをコメントアウトすると元に戻ります。「stream.publish」を使用した呼び出しは正常に機能します。

私の初期化コード:

FB ツールで生成された Like ボタンのコード:

FB.ui 呼び出し:

FB.ui が呼び出されたときにユーザーが受け取るエラー:

どんな助けでも大歓迎です!

0 投票する
1 に答える
4721 参照

facebook - Facebook API エラー 100 エラー メッセージ: 公開投稿しようとすると、redirect_uri URL が適切にフォーマットされていません

以前は動作していたアプリケーションである FBApp を介してウォールに投稿しようとすると、このエラーが発生しますが、昨日、このエラーがスローされていることに気付きました。

私のアプリはユーザーをログに記録しており、すべてが機能しており、投稿しようとするとエラーがスローされます。投稿に使用するコードは次のとおりです。

もう1つのことは、私が使用しているhttpsドメインがホスティング共有SSLであることです: https://vivaro.websitewelcome.com/~username

何か案は?